Filter Episode 11 Recap
> Filter Recap
With the cooperation of Su Qingli and Lin Yuan, Su Chengcheng successfully pulled off her disguise. What’s more, Tang Qi developed deep admiration for Fang Jin. During their conversation, Tang Qi's thoughts drifted back to Su Miao, causing him to feel somewhat depressed. He realized that he had been thinking about Fang Jin constantly, which made him feel like a fickle man who easily fell for different women.
The next day at work, Su Chengcheng happened to take the elevator with Tang Qi and noticed that he seemed down. She found it odd, as he had clearly enjoyed his meeting with Fang Jin the previous night—his sudden shift in attitude was puzzling. It wasn’t until the other people in the elevator started discussing a movie that Su Chengcheng realized his mood might be related to Su Miao.
Meanwhile, Guan Shengyu reached out to another company, attempting to sell Fang Jin’s patent. To sabotage the deal, Su Chengcheng and her sister devised a plan. First, Su Chengcheng, disguised as Fang Jin, arranged to meet Tang Qi at a café. Then, she deliberately revealed some documents in front of Guan Shengyu, making him believe that Tang Qi was meeting with President Xiang.
Thinking that Tang Qi was trying to sabotage his business deal, Guan Shengyu rushed to confront him at the café. At the same time, Su Chengcheng, still disguised as Fang Jin, went with her sister to the new partner company and rejected the collaboration. After waiting at the café for a long time with no sign of the new partner, Guan Shengyu realized he had been tricked. He hurried to find President Xiang but ran into Su Chengcheng instead.
Unable to hold back her frustration, Su Chengcheng wanted to hit Guan Shengyu but noticed the surveillance cameras and deliberately acted weak. Just as Guan Shengyu was about to make a move, Tang Qi suddenly appeared to protect "Fang Jin" but ended up getting hit himself. Since the final patent for the product had not been decided, the product concept remained unclear. As a result, the business partners Gu Yu had contacted were unwilling to invest.
Just as Gu Yu and Tang Qi were struggling to convince them, the client’s daughter ran in and saw the book that she had previously asked Gu Yu to get signed by Lin Yuan. Touched by the effort and sincerity, the client decided to continue supporting Qianiaoji Corporation. On the way back, Gu Yu suggested having a meal together to celebrate Fang Jin’s help. Tang Qi, however, became visibly nervous and firmly opposed the idea.
He felt that since he had once loved Su Miao, he shouldn’t develop feelings for another woman. Gu Yu noticed Tang Qi’s strange behavior but didn’t comment on it, choosing instead to comfort him. To ease Tang Qi’s struggle, Gu Yu suggested that his feelings for Fang Jin might just be sympathy, which Tang Qi had misinterpreted as affection. He assured Tang Qi that after spending more time with Fang Jin, he would understand their true relationship.
After hearing Gu Yu’s reasoning, Tang Qi decided to test himself and immediately went to find Fang Jin. At the company, Su Chengcheng was working overtime with Wang Yi—since their team consisted of only the two of them. When Xu Yue left work, she even mocked Su Chengcheng. While Su Chengcheng was busy working, she received a message from Tang Qi, saying he wanted to see Fang Jin.
Not wanting to meet him, Su Chengcheng used work as an excuse to refuse, but Tang Qi insisted on going to the lab to find Fang Jin. With no other choice, she hurriedly left the company and rushed to the lab to play her role. When Tang Qi arrived at Fang Jin’s lab, he pretended to ask about technical issues. Su Chengcheng panicked upon hearing this—since she didn’t actually understand the technology, she feared he would see through her act.
To divert the conversation, she quickly claimed to be hungry and suggested they eat first and talk later. During the meal, both were preoccupied with their own thoughts. Tang Qi was trying hard to suppress his emotions and not reveal any affection, while Su Chengcheng was worried about slipping up. Suddenly, a power outage occurred, locking the electronic door and trapping them inside the lab.
Instead of panicking, Su Chengcheng was secretly relieved—without power, the computers couldn’t turn on, meaning she wouldn’t have to discuss technical matters with Tang Qi. Unbeknownst to them, the power outage was no accident. Guan Shengyu, suspecting that Tang Qi and Fang Jin had a romantic relationship, had orchestrated the blackout, hoping to catch them in a compromising situation.
